Responsibilities

Job Summary:

Reporting to the Sales Representative, the Sales Intern will be a key member of the HarperCollins Canada Sales team. Our team is responsible for the sales, distribution and promotion of all HarperCollins titles in Canada.

 

In this role, you will have the opportunity to intersect with all stages of the publishing process and establish relationships in each department. You will be mentored by a senior member of our team and have the opportunity for one-on-one meetings with employees across the organization. Your responsibilities will include attending weekly cross-department meetings, attending brainstorm and planning sessions, contributing to sales presentations and providing valuable feedback on various promotions aimed at our accounts and consumers.

 

Duties and Responsibilities:

  • Create, update, and distribute catalogues and order forms for accounts and Sales Reps
  • Present titles for sell-in to accounts in multiple channels. This includes but is not limited to in-person appointments, Microsoft Teams appointments and phone appointments
  • Perform research and sales analysis, including merchandising tasks (reports, audits)
  • Assist with our Seasonal Sales Conference through taking notes on important discussions, presenting titles, and creating the power-point presentations for the Line Managers.
  • Place orders for accounts, authors and events.
  • Complete book mailings for Sales Reps and Directors.
  • Assist with account outreach efforts through both online research and in-person store visits.
  • Perform various tasks relating to our participation at the CGTA Gift & Home Market including set-up/tear down at the venue as well as in-person during the show.

About HarperCollins Canada and Harlequin

Harlequin is a leading publisher of commercial fiction and narrative nonfiction. We publish more than 100 titles a month that reach audiences globally. Encompassing highly recognizable imprints that span a broad number of genres, we are home to many award-winning New York Times and USA TODAY bestselling authors. Harlequin is a division of HarperCollins Publishers, the second-largest consumer book publisher in the world. Through HarperCollins’s global publishing program, Harlequin titles are published in 17 countries and 16 languages.

 

Known worldwide for the quality of its list, HarperCollins Canada is the proud home of many bestselling and award-winning authors, including Esi Edugyan, Heather O’Neill, and Lawrence Hill. It is our vision to publish the best books of our generation and to work with authors over the length and breadth of their careers. Our authors are at the centre of everything we do. In addition to the Canadian publishing program, HarperCollins Canada is responsible for the sales, marketing, and publicity of HarperCollins titles from around the globe.
